The owner's insights on the AquaMax Eco Titanium Gravity Filter Pump

A gravity-fed pond works the opposite way to most. Water drains by gravity from the bottom of the pond into the filter. The pump sits after it and returns clean water. That job needs a pump that moves a great deal of water with very little lift. The AquaMax Eco Titanium does exactly that, from 33,000 to 81,000 litres an hour.

The housing is stainless steel, cast on the new 33000. The larger 51000 and 81000 use silicon carbide ceramic for the rotor shaft and bearings. Oase rate all three for salt and chlorinated water, so they suit swimming ponds and natural pools as well as koi ponds.

It is the wrong pump for a pond without bottom drains. If your filter sits beside the pond and a pump pushes water up to it, you want head, not volume. The AquaMax Eco Expert is the better choice.

Work out whether this is your pump, then which size

Step one: is yours a gravity-fed system?

Your setup Is Titanium right? Why
Bottom drain feeding a filter beside the pond, water returning by gravity Yes, this is what it is built for High volume at low head is exactly this job
A pump in the pond pushing up to a filter Usually not An AquaMax Eco Premium or Expert costs less for the same result
A tall waterfall No Maximum head here is 3.5 to 5.5 m; flow drops away quickly as head rises
Salt or chlorinated water Yes The stainless housing is rated for fresh, salt and chlorinated water

Step two: match the flow to the filter, not the pond

  1. 1. Find your filter maximum flow, in litres per hour. That number caps the pump, not the other way round.
  2. 2. On a koi system, most builders turn the pond over roughly once every one to two hours.
  3. 3. Pick the model whose flow sits at, or a little under, the filter rating: 33,000, 51,000 or 81,000 l/h.
  4. 4. Check the head: 3.5 m on the 33000, 4.0 m on the 51000, 5.5 m on the 81000. Gravity systems rarely need more.

What it costs to run

Model Draw Per day at 24 h Per year
AquaMax Eco Titanium 33000 30 to 145 W $0.22 to $1.04 $79 to $381
AquaMax Eco Titanium 51000 70 to 320 W $0.50 to $2.30 $184 to $841
AquaMax Eco Titanium 81000 100 to 730 W $0.72 to $5.26 $263 to $1,918

Worked at 30c per kWh running 24 hours a day, which is our assumption rather than a manufacturer figure. Put your own tariff against the wattage and the sums are the same.

A gravity system runs continuously, so this is the number that matters over a decade. All three are variable speed: the low figure is a quiet winter setting, the high one is full summer load.

Frequently asked questions

What is a gravity filter pump?

In a gravity-fed system the pond water flows by gravity from bottom drains into the filter. The pump sits after the filter in a pump chamber. It returns clean water to the pond. That means the pump moves a lot of water with little lift, which is what the Titanium is built for.

Which size do I need?

Match it to your filter. A ProfiClear Premium DF-L gravity-fed handles up to 33,000 l/h, which suits the 33000. Larger filter systems and swimming ponds step up to the 51000 or 81000. Send us the filter model and pond volume. We will confirm it.

Can it go in salt or chlorinated water?

Yes. Oase rate the AquaMax Eco Titanium for salt and chlorinated water, which is why it suits swimming ponds and natural pools.

Can it run out of the water?

Yes. It can run submerged or dry installed. Oase design it to sit in a pump chamber.

How much power does it use?

The 33000 draws 30 to 145 W, the 51000 draws 70 to 320 W and the 81000 draws 100 to 730 W, depending on how far the flow is turned up. Oase say the 33000 uses up to 20% less energy than the model before it.
